Palo Verde just recently implemented SAM-12 tool monitors and we have
not experienced this situation (yet).  Prior to using the SAMs, we used
tool monitors that relied on door operation to automatically start the
counting cycle.  The described situation is an inherent feature of the
SAMs and from a corrective action perspective you would be faced with
prohibiting workers from using unless they had direct RP supervision or
perhaps implementing an advanced radworker qualification to use a tool
monitor.

SONGS allows workers to monitor personal articles in SAM-9 and SAM-11
tool monitors under limited supervision by HP.   We have had occasions
where workers place material in the monitors, and do not push the start
button, or place items in the SAM during a background count.  While an
attentive worker can observe fault messages, it appears the messages
from the SAM-11 are less distinct than those produced by the SAM-9.
Some workers have passed items through SAM-11s without an actual count. 


Does anyone else have similar experiences?  How have you responded?
